SOFA API  6a688117
Open source framework for multi-physics simuation
sofa::gui::qt::QDisplayDataInfoWidget Class Reference

#include <DataWidget.h>

Inheritance diagram for sofa::gui::qt::QDisplayDataInfoWidget:

Protected Attributes

core::objectmodel::BaseDatadata
 
unsigned int numLines_
 
QLineEditlinkpath_edit
 

Public Member Functions

 QDisplayDataInfoWidget (QWidget *parent, const std::string &helper, core::objectmodel::BaseData *d, bool modifiable, const ModifyObjectFlags &modifyObjectFlags)
 

Protected Member Functions

void formatHelperString (const std::string &helper, std::string &final_text)
 

Static Protected Member Functions

static QIcon & LinkIcon ()
 
static unsigned int numLines (const std::string &str)
 

Signals

void WidgetDirty ()
 

Public Slots

void linkModification ()
 
void linkEdited ()
 
unsigned int getNumLines () const
 

Attribute details

core::objectmodel::BaseData* sofa::gui::qt::QDisplayDataInfoWidget::data
protected
QLineEdit* sofa::gui::qt::QDisplayDataInfoWidget::linkpath_edit
protected
unsigned int sofa::gui::qt::QDisplayDataInfoWidget::numLines_
protected

Constructor details

sofa::gui::qt::QDisplayDataInfoWidget::QDisplayDataInfoWidget ( QWidget parent,
const std::string &  helper,
core::objectmodel::BaseData d,
bool  modifiable,
const ModifyObjectFlags modifyObjectFlags 
)

Function details

void sofa::gui::qt::QDisplayDataInfoWidget::formatHelperString ( const std::string &  helper,
std::string &  final_text 
)
protected
unsigned int sofa::gui::qt::QDisplayDataInfoWidget::getNumLines ( ) const
inlineslot
void sofa::gui::qt::QDisplayDataInfoWidget::linkEdited ( )
slot
static QIcon& sofa::gui::qt::QDisplayDataInfoWidget::LinkIcon ( )
inlinestaticprotected
void sofa::gui::qt::QDisplayDataInfoWidget::linkModification ( )
slot
unsigned int sofa::gui::qt::QDisplayDataInfoWidget::numLines ( const std::string &  str)
staticprotected
void sofa::gui::qt::QDisplayDataInfoWidget::WidgetDirty ( )
signal